Output eb6f1bc6b9ee5d7ccc65a0a35759b529ea29474c991ea4ccbec2e016bbf07ec4:1

value
28479431
script pubkey
OP_HASH160 OP_PUSHBYTES_20 995871b7c1713e85b7553db7645f5445b191176f OP_EQUAL
address
3FfqG74MPMXC66uDWS6TkZUq4BCguLPNAA
transaction
eb6f1bc6b9ee5d7ccc65a0a35759b529ea29474c991ea4ccbec2e016bbf07ec4
confirmations
352519
spent
true